The UK Prime Minister is in an awkward position following the US’ action in Venezuela. 

President Nicolas Maduro was taken in a US military operation over the weekend, and is soon to stand trial in New York on drugs and weapons charges.   

Keir Starmer told the BBC he will shed no tears over the end of Nicolas Maduro's regime, but is not prepared to comment on the US military action in Venezuela. 

But UK Correspondent Rod Liddle told Andrew Dickens Starmer is under a lot of pressure to condemn the actions of the US.
